What is Student Curriculum Vitae Template?
A Student Curriculum Vitae (CV) Template is a document that outlines the academic and personal achievements of a student. It serves as a comprehensive summary of the student's qualifications, skills, and experiences, which can be crucial when applying for educational programs, scholarships, internships, or entry-level job positions. The template provides a structured format and guidelines for organizing and presenting the student's information in an organized and professional manner.
What are the types of Student Curriculum Vitae Template?
There are various types of Student Curriculum Vitae Templates available, each catering to different needs and objectives. Some common types include:
Academic CV Template: Specifically designed for students applying for academic positions or educational programs. It focuses on academic achievements, research experience, publications, and presentations.
Internship CV Template: Tailored for students seeking internships. This type emphasizes relevant coursework, internships, volunteer work, and extracurricular activities.
Entry-Level CV Template: Suitable for students entering the job market for the first time. It highlights education, skills, part-time jobs, and any relevant experiences.
Scholarship CV Template: Geared towards students applying for scholarships or grants. It emphasizes academic achievements, awards, community involvement, and leadership roles.
How to complete Student Curriculum Vitae Template
Completing a Student Curriculum Vitae Template can seem daunting, but with the right approach, it can be an effective tool to showcase your qualifications.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you:
01
Start with a heading that includes your full name, contact details, and a professional summary or objective statement.
02
Include your educational background, starting with your most recent institution, degree, major, and graduation date. List any relevant coursework, honors, or academic achievements.
03
Highlight your research projects, internships, or practical experiences related to your field of study. Provide details on the tasks performed, skills developed, and results achieved.
04
Outline your extracurricular activities, such as leadership roles, volunteer work, clubs, or sports teams. Emphasize any transferable skills gained from these activities.
05
Include a section for skills and competencies, both technical and interpersonal. Mention any languages spoken, computer proficiency, or certifications obtained.
06
List your work experience, if applicable, focusing on part-time jobs, internships, or relevant projects. Provide details on responsibilities, achievements, and skills utilized.
07
End with a section for references or testimonials, if required. Include contact information for individuals who can vouch for your abilities and character.
08
Proofread your completed CV template thoroughly to ensure accuracy, consistency, and professional language.
09
Save the document in a PDF format to maintain formatting and prevent unintentional changes.
